Yanes\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eDetails\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eISBN:\u003c\/strong\u003e 9781041012269\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003ePublished:\u003c\/strong\u003e 2026\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eFormat:\u003c\/strong\u003e Hardcover\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eLanguage:\u003c\/strong\u003e English\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003ePublisher:\u003c\/strong\u003e Routledge\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eDescription\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eInternational investment law and international human rights law have long operated in parallel, often pulling states in opposing directions. This book addresses one of the most contested fault lines between them: the privatisation of social rights services — water, health, education, and housing — and the legal conflicts that arise when investment tribunals assess state regulation in these sectors.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eLuis F. Yanes demonstrates how investment protections have routinely been applied in ways that constrain governments from fulfilling their human rights obligations, and in some cases have directly contributed to violations. Drawing on a systematic analysis of treaty practice and arbitral awards, the book develops a detailed interpretive method for harmonising investment and human rights law within the existing scope of the investment regime — without requiring treaty reform.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e analysis moves from fragmentation to integration, showing that the two fields are not inherently incompatible.
